Transaction 53f2779494198ccb3777b11158dbe36ba8043e5e8f69a379fb45f4d586e09963

1 Input
2 Outputs
  • 53f2779494198ccb3777b11158dbe36ba8043e5e8f69a379fb45f4d586e09963:0
  • value  576300
    address  3ENGqcPAs9JAV618P9J6KmKHh9Lm4QKwMn
  • 53f2779494198ccb3777b11158dbe36ba8043e5e8f69a379fb45f4d586e09963:1
  • value  48992935
    address  34CRtRPVXHPAYsMbAyfNXkW7SA1CKYPR2f